Understanding the Healthcare Market and Biotech Industry
To effectively day trade biotech stocks, you must first grasp the broader healthcare market and the specific nuances of the biotech industry. The healthcare sector encompasses a wide range of companies involved in pharmaceuticals, medical devices, biotechnology, and healthcare services. Within this sector, biotech firms focus on developing drugs and therapies based on biological processes.
This specialization often leads to significant price fluctuations based on news releases, research findings, and market trends. The biotech industry is characterized by its innovation and rapid advancements. Companies often invest heavily in research and development, which can lead to breakthroughs that dramatically impact stock prices.
As you delve into this market, pay attention to key events such as earnings reports, FDA approvals, and clinical trial results. These events can serve as catalysts for price movements, providing opportunities for day traders like yourself to capitalize on short-term fluctuations.
Risks and Challenges of Day Trading Biotech Stocks
While day trading biotech stocks can be lucrative, it is not without its risks and challenges. One of the primary concerns is the inherent volatility of these stocks. Biotech companies often experience sharp price swings based on news announcements or changes in market sentiment.
As a day trader, you must be prepared for sudden price movements that can lead to significant gains or losses in a matter of minutes. Another challenge you may face is the complexity of the biotech industry itself. Understanding the science behind drug development and clinical trials can be daunting.
You may find it difficult to assess the potential impact of news releases or research findings without a solid grasp of the underlying science. This complexity can lead to misinterpretations and poor trading decisions if you are not adequately informed. Therefore, investing time in research and education is crucial for navigating these challenges effectively.
Strategies for Day Trading Biotech Stocks
Developing a robust trading strategy is essential for success in day trading biotech stocks. One effective approach is to focus on news-driven trading. By staying informed about upcoming clinical trial results, FDA announcements, and other significant events, you can position yourself to take advantage of price movements that follow these announcements.
Setting alerts for key dates and monitoring news sources will help you stay ahead of potential trading opportunities. Another strategy involves technical analysis. By analyzing historical price patterns and trading volumes, you can identify trends that may indicate future price movements.
Utilizing charting tools and indicators can provide valuable insights into market behavior, allowing you to make more informed trading decisions. Combining technical analysis with your understanding of fundamental factors can enhance your overall strategy and improve your chances of success.
Technical Analysis and Fundamental Analysis in Biotech Day Trading
In day trading biotech stocks, both technical analysis and fundamental analysis play crucial roles in shaping your trading decisions. Technical analysis involves examining price charts and patterns to identify trends and potential entry or exit points. You may use various indicators such as moving averages, Relative Strength Index (RSI), or Bollinger Bands to gauge market momentum and volatility.
By mastering these tools, you can develop a keen sense of when to enter or exit a trade based on historical price behavior. On the other hand, fundamental analysis focuses on evaluating a company’s financial health and growth potential. In the biotech sector, this often involves scrutinizing clinical trial results, pipeline developments, and regulatory approvals.
Understanding a company’s financial statements, research progress, and competitive landscape will provide you with valuable context for your trades. By combining both technical and fundamental analyses, you can create a well-rounded approach that enhances your decision-making process.
Tips for Successful Day Trading in Healthcare Markets
Develop a Disciplined Trading Plan
Having a clear plan will help you stay focused during volatile market conditions and prevent emotional decision-making. This plan should outline your goals, risk tolerance, and specific strategies.
Practice Risk Management
Setting stop-loss orders can limit potential losses on each trade. This strategy allows you to protect your capital while still taking advantage of profitable opportunities.
Diversify Your Portfolio
Trading multiple biotech stocks rather than concentrating on a single company can help mitigate risks associated with individual stock volatility.
Common Mistakes to Avoid in Day Trading Biotech Stocks
As you embark on your day trading journey in biotech stocks, it is essential to be aware of common pitfalls that could hinder your success. One prevalent mistake is overreacting to news or rumors without conducting thorough research. In the fast-paced world of biotech trading, it can be tempting to jump on trends based solely on headlines.
However, taking the time to analyze the underlying information will lead to more informed decisions. Another mistake is neglecting to adapt your strategy based on changing market conditions. The biotech landscape is dynamic, with new developments occurring regularly.
Failing to adjust your approach in response to these changes can result in missed opportunities or increased losses. Stay flexible and open-minded as you refine your strategies based on real-time market feedback.
